Transaction 01104f30cfdff29436f72d1a386c143cd7353214c016f56359d9e15468c1b461

1 Input
2 Outputs
  • 01104f30cfdff29436f72d1a386c143cd7353214c016f56359d9e15468c1b461:0
  • value  100000000
    address  3AczU39bbTFwchgVXMVp9fy61M8cntayHx
  • 01104f30cfdff29436f72d1a386c143cd7353214c016f56359d9e15468c1b461:1
  • value  2501428821
    address  3DtfG7Dosg6KpqXAyfmpsAnfF8tbRSX6Hi